An AMOS based shareware adventure game from Satchel Software in 1991. Flowers of Crystal is an educational game from the author of Granny's Garden. The game was designed to provide for creative activities in the classroom and is built around puzzle-solving. It consists of three parts: an introductory story and an adventure in two parts. A password from the first part is required to start the second. The introductory story is also included recorded on an audio tape as well as printed in a booklet. The game takes place on the planet Crystal which once had vast expanses of colorful flowers that are now thought to be extinct. The player is a visitor from Earth who explores the planet in an attempt to find the last remaining flower. In the first part, the player has to find four objects (special water, gold pot, fertilizer and soil). The game play involves traveling between seven locations (center, city, factory, forest, lake, desert and mountains) and choosing which items to carry. The game starts out at the center where the player chooses four items from three different menus. Items are needed when visiting some of the locations or give some protection when encountering hazards or some of the world's hostile creatures. The second part involves finding six parts of a flower dream to recreate a complete flower picture and then go to a castle. To progress it is necessary to obtain spells and use them at the right location. Game was distributed in a clear plastic satchel with disks and other items packed inside the manual. Hence the manual covers also serve as a "box cover"
